THE ORIGINAL IRISH COFFEE RECIPE - THE SPRUCE EATS
Nov 21, 2021 · When made with an 80-proof whiskey in the measurements given in the recipe, the Irish coffee is relatively gentle at right around 9 percent ABV (18 proof). While the alcohol effect may be minimal, drinking Irish coffee will keep some people awake. If you don't usually drink caffeine at night, use decaffeinated coffee.

IRISH COFFEE - WIKIPEDIA
Origin. Different variations of coffee cocktails pre-date the now-classic Irish coffee by at least 100 years. From the mid-19th century, the Pharisäer and the Fiaker were served in Viennese coffee houses; both were coffee cocktails served in glass, topped with whipped cream.The former was also known in northern Germany and Denmark around that time. .
